Places to See in Kharsali

Kharsali has 4 tourist spots and places to see.

Being in close proximity to religious destinations, majority of the sightseeing locations at Kharsali have mythological connotations, especially from the Mahabharata epic. There is a temple dedicated to Lord Siva in his Someshwar form that is visited by the devotees. There is also a temple dedicated Shani Dev, son of Surya deity at Kharsali.

Some other places to see in Kharsali

Janki Chatti: Janki Chatti is located at a distance of just 1kms from Kharsali and is the starting point of the trek to Yamunotri temple. Janki Chatti is also known for its thermal springs where devotees take bath before visiting Yamunotri.

Yamunotri: The highest and the most revered temple of river Yamuna which is given the status of Goddess, it is situated at an elevation of 3293mts above the sea level. Te trek to Yamunotri starts from Janki Chatti and can be covered on foot as well as on Ponies. The trek of 7kms from Janki Chatti can be covered in one day and is considered to be of easy and moderate level.
